First step is to unlock the bootloader. Go to HTCdev.com and there are instructions to unlock the bootloader. Note this will erase everything on your phone so make sure to back up. Then you have to install a custom recovery. I like TWRP. TWRP: https://twrp.me/devices/htconexinternational.html Follow the instructions on that page under Fastboot Install Method (No Root Required).
Then you need superSU SuperSU: http://download.chainfire.eu/supersu Put that on your phone and then go to recovery and install that and you will be rooted.

First download Odin http://www.downloadodin.info/download-odin-3-07
Then download the TWRP: https://twrp.me/devices/samsunggalaxys5qualcomm.html
Follow the instructions for using ODIN. Press the PDA button and load TWRP that you downloaded.
On your phone power it down.
With the phone off pres the Volume down, Home, and Power button.
The phone will give you the option to go into Download mode or reset.
Go into download mode and plug in your phone. Tap on Start
Power down your device and press volume up, home and power until your phone turns on. Then tap on reboot. Tap system. And then it will ask you if you want to install SuperSu. say yes and you are rooted.

You probably have T-Mobile. The best thing to use is Wifi Tether Router. T-Mobile sees that you are using the data from your phone as a hotspot and that takes the data from the 4GB allotment. With Wifi Tether Router it will mark the traffic as coming from your phone and not from a computer.
